"Step-and-repeat" is the term used for the process of duplicating an object and spacing. Typically step and repeat is used in an object-oriented program, such as InDesign, rather than in a pixel-based editor, such as Photoshop. Press Control-J to duplicate the Circle layer. Go to Filter > Other > Offset. Set the Horizontal and Vertical offset 300px (the canvas size 600px divided by 2). Now you have a tiling repeating image that you can save as pattern in Photoshop. Go to Edit > Define Pattern.

Double click the test layer and apply a Pattern Overlay. Choose your newly created pattern from the library. At 100% the pattern will be the same size as the document, so reduce the Scale to see how the pattern seamlessly repeats.
